摘要
云网络架构采用控制与转发分离机制实现了资源的灵活分配,为了满足云网络架构的资源分配符合多业务的资源需求,提出了一种基于云网络架构的虚拟网络映射算法,提高了资源利用率。建立的虚拟网络映射算法模型,给出了虚拟网络映射算法的约束条件和优化目标。针对语音、视频和数据3种业务进行了仿真,结果表明,提出的算法提高了控制资源利用率、转发资源利用率和链路资源利用率。
The cloud network architecture uses the forwarding and control element separation mechanism to realize the flexible allocation of resources. In order to meet the resource requirement that the resource allocation of cloud network architecture is accordance with the multi-service, a virtual network mapping algorithm based on cloud network architecture is proposed to improve the resource utilization. The established virtual network mapping algorithm model gives its constraint condition and optimization objective. The three kinds of business such as voice, data and video are simulated. The results show that the proposed algorithm can improve the utilization of control resource, forwarding resource and link resource.
